Contributor Name: Eleni Yitbarek

Dr Eleni Yitbarek is a senior lecturer at the University of Pretoria and a junior fellow at the Pan-African Scientific Research Council. She obtained her PhD in Development Economics from Maastricht University in the Netherlands and has a strong background in quantitative analysis, with extensive experience in designing and analysing household survey data for poverty and inequality analyses. Her interest is primarily in economic development, especially the role that social and economic policies play in it.
